Problems with linkedin when I copy and paste the url address and leave the field automatically change everything I copied.
Example: Im copy this Link: https://www.linkedin.com/in/compupage/
When I move to the next field, the link automatic changed for this: //instagram.com/compupage
The program remove https:

Hi George,

Our developers have investigated the problem with the social icons protocol in the links. And that is what they have responded. The inserted address is processed as it should, but you do not see it at full length as it is. That is because the inserted string is long and it is stripped to a parameter. The main link is left without a protocol so when using these social icons on the live site, the site domain protocol is used and the social network can handle this query according to its rules.

Hi,

Social icons control creates shared links for your pages.
For Facebook, insert please username, it will add the link, or insert the full link, for example, https://facebook.com/_your_username_
For LinkedIn insert a full link with https - https://linkedin.com/in/leena-matikka-25166457 - it should work.
As for incorrect showing of social icons - do they show up correctly when you switch to Responsive views?

responsive.png

If not - you should align them for each responsive view.

I am also having the same problem with the social icons when adding a link to the Linkedin setting. Nicepage is adding "//linkedin.com/shareArticle?title=&mini=true&url=" to the URL. It doesn't matter how many times I copy and paste the correct URL, the software is still adding the extra information. I am having the exact same problem with the Facebook link. Nicepage is adding "http://facebook.com" to the beginning of the URL. I have version 1.0.228.

The problem is embarrassing because it's now on a live site for a customer and I can't find which file to edit out the extra URL information for that particular social icon. If I knew which file I could find where the link is being generated from, I can edit it on the server.

UPDATE

I think I found a work-around for this problem.

First, I found if I don't copy and paste the Facebook link in, and simply add the remaining URL information after the slash, Nicepage will not revert back to the http://facebook.com/ URL. It also doesn't appear to like https: in the URL either.

Second, I added "http:" in front of the two // on the LinkedIn link, and then omitted the extra fluff after the trailing / on the URL and added the remaining link information after the last / and it seemed to also take without reverting back.

Despite finding a work-around, I still think this is a bug and should be addressed in the next update.
